HIGHWAY TRAGEDY.
YOUNG BOY KILLED, Per Press Association. AUCKLAND, June 16. One boy was killed : and another seriously injured in a motor accident at an intersection in Opotiki this afternoon. The victims were.—Killed: Charles Joseph Donaldson,: aged 7. Injured; Thomas Arthur Donaldson, aged 9. Mr T. Donaldson, the father of, the boys, swung the truck he' was driving sharply - to the right in an attempt to avoid a collision with a car driven by Mr J. R. Washburn,- of Hamilton, but. the vehicle overturned and his sons, who were with him in the cab, were thrown to the road. The younger bov was crushed bv the body of the truck and killed instantly, while the other was extricated suffering from a lacerated scalp and concussion.
